Common Causes of Pedestrian Accidents in Yuba City
Pedestrian collisions happen for many different reasons. Some involve reckless driving, while others stem from choices that drivers could have easily avoided. In Yuba City, several patterns recur in the cases we handle, including the following:
- Distracted Driving – Phones pose a significant danger, since even a brief glance down can hide a pedestrian from view. Other distractions also trigger preventable collisions.
- Speeding – Speeding increases stopping distance and raises the risk of severe or fatal injuries for pedestrians.
- Failure to Yield – Crashes happen when drivers ignore crosswalks, rush turns, roll stops, and fail to look for pedestrians.
- Poor Visibility – Early mornings, evenings, and weather conditions reduce visibility. Drivers need to pay closer attention, slow down, and scan their surroundings. Many do not.
- Impaired Driving – Alcohol and drugs reduce reaction time and judgment. Impaired drivers often fail to notice pedestrians until it is too late.
- Parking Lot and Driveway Accidents – These areas create blind spots, especially when drivers back out quickly. Children and shorter adults are at higher risk because they fall below the driver’s sightline.
Understanding the events leading to the crash helps shape a strong claim and gives your case a firm foundation of evidence.
What to Do After a Pedestrian Accident
The steps you take immediately after an accident can protect both your health and your potential claim. You should do the following:
- Get Medical Care Right Away – Pedestrians often suffer hidden injuries such as internal trauma, head injuries, or fractures. Seeing a doctor creates a clear record of your condition and ties your symptoms to the collision.
- Call Law Enforcement – A police report includes witness statements, diagrams, and the officer’s notes. This documentation strengthens your claim.
- Collect Information if You Can – Write down the driver’s name, license plate number, and insurance details. If witnesses saw the crash, gather their contact information.
- Take Photos or Videos of the Scene – Capture vehicles, skid marks, the roadway, and visible injuries. If you cannot do this yourself, ask someone nearby to help.
- Avoid Giving Statements to Insurance Companies on Your Own – Adjusters may push you to say things that reduce the driver’s responsibility. Speak with a lawyer before responding.

What Are California’s Pedestrian Laws?
California gives strong legal protections to pedestrians. Understanding these rules helps determine fault.
- Right-of-Way at Crosswalks – Whether marked or unmarked, drivers must slow down and yield to pedestrians crossing the street.
- Due Care Requirement – Drivers must watch for pedestrians at all times, especially near schools, intersections, and residential areas.
- Prohibition on Passing Stopped Vehicles – If a car stops at a crosswalk, another driver cannot pass, since a pedestrian may be crossing.
- Pedestrian Responsibilities – Pedestrians also have duties, such as crossing safely and avoiding sudden movements that place them in a driver’s path. However, even if a pedestrian made a mistake, the driver may still be found partly at fault.
Under California’s comparative fault system, you may recover compensation even if you hold partial responsibility. Strong analysis of the facts supports and protects your claim.
Types of Compensation for Pedestrian Accident Victims
A pedestrian hit by a vehicle often faces steep financial and emotional challenges. Compensation depends on the facts of the case, but may include the following:
- Medical Expenses – This includes emergency care, hospital stays, surgeries, imaging, prescriptions, and long-term treatment.
- Future Medical Costs – Many pedestrians need ongoing physical therapy, follow-up appointments, or specialist care.
- Lost Income – If your injuries keep you out of work, you may recover lost wages and future earning potential.
- Pain and Suffering – Pedestrian accidents frequently cause intense physical pain and long-lasting emotional distress.
- Mobility Aids and Home Modifications – Severe injuries sometimes require wheelchairs, walkers, or changes to your living space.
- Loss of Enjoyment of Life – When injuries prevent you from doing the things you once enjoyed, the law allows compensation for this loss.
